您的位置:首页 > 编程语言 > C#

c#中实现朗读文本功能

2016-04-18 09:19 435 查看
这里要用的微软自带TTS语音引擎。

本人是实在.net framework 4.0 上测试的

首先需要引用System.Speech

//  text为输入文本内容
public static void Speak(string text)
{
using (SpeechSynthesizer speech = new SpeechSynthesizer())
{
speech.Rate = int.Parse("0");//语速  介于-10于10之间
speech.Speak(text);
}
}


就这么easy 。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  .net c#